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

OCR depth learning method based on block chain mechanism, storage medium

A technology of deep learning and blockchain, applied in the field of OCR deep learning methods based on the storage medium and blockchain mechanism, can solve a lot of learning time and other problems, achieve the effect of improving learning efficiency, increasing enterprise value, and reducing learning time

Active Publication Date: 2019-02-15
福建天晴在线互动科技有限公司
View PDF2 Cites 6 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

And every time there is an additional font, there are tens of thousands of characters in Chinese characters alone, which requires a lot of learning time

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• OCR depth learning method based on block chain mechanism, storage medium
  • OCR depth learning method based on block chain mechanism, stor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0051] Please refer to figure 2 , this embodiment is for figure 2 A further definition of the OCR deep learning method based on the block chain mechanism is provided, including the following steps:

[0052] S1: Build a blockchain network platform.

[0053] Build a blockchain network platform, that is, a blockchain network. Each node of the blockchain network platform stores the same data and is open for use by default.

[0054] S2: Share and store OCR identification data to each node of the blockchain network.

[0055] Based on the data sharing feature of the blockchain, the OCR identification data can be obtained by any machine to achieve reusability. For example, if a new personalized font is released, if you want to be able to recognize the font, you need to perform deep learning on its OCR recognition data.

[0056] S2: Create a model consisting of each state and its corresponding current reward according to the learning data, where each state corresponds to each sub-l...

Embodiment 2

[0076] This embodiment is a specific application scenario corresponding to Embodiment 1:

[0077] The OCR deep learning method based on the blockchain mechanism can be aimed at the ever-changing personalized Chinese characters, English and Martian characters, traditional Chinese, foreign languages ​​and other unconventional characters.

[0078] For example, when a new personalized text comes out, its font is unconventional and may not be found in the known font library, so if the machine wants to learn such text recognition, deep learning is required, and using the first embodiment The method can achieve the purpose of safety and speed.

[0079] Specifically, when identifying new personalized fonts, first select characters with fewer strokes. First, according to the deep learning method, a template is given corresponding to a word (that is, the established model, deep learning is to learn by the machine after giving the established goal, and the template here refers to the es...

Embodiment 3

[0085] This embodiment corresponds to Embodiment 1 or Embodiment 2, and provides a computer-readable storage medium on which a computer program is stored. When the program is processed by a processor, it can realize the above-mentioned embodiment 1 or Embodiment 2. The steps included in the OCR deep learning method based on the blockchain mechanism. The specific steps will not be repeated here, please refer to the description of Embodiment 1 or Embodiment 2 for details.

[0086] Those of ordinary skill in the art can understand that all or part of the processes in the technical solution of the above-mentioned embodiment 1 or embodiment 2 can be realized by instructing related hardware through a computer program, and the program can be stored in a computer In the readable storage medium, when the program is executed, it may include the processes of the above-mentioned methods.

[0087] Wherein, the storage medium may be a magnetic disk, an optical disk, a read-only memory (Rea...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ides an OCR depth learning method based on a block chain mechanism. The storage medium comprises: a model composed of each state and its corresponding immediate return is created according to the learning data. The states correspond to each sub-learning data in the learning data. Private storage model to the nodes of the block chain network; The states in the model are randomly selected for training, and the new returns corresponding to the states are obtained. Obtaining a training model corresponding to the model according to the new reward optimization model; Convolution depth learning is carried out according to the training model set corresponding to a sufficient number of models. Share the results of convolutional depth learning to each node. The invention can realize resource sharing of learning data. It can effectively protect the self-learning results, improve the learning value, and help to accelerate the progress of research and development; But also guarantees user data privacy.

Description

technical field [0001] The invention relates to an OCR deep learning method, in particular to an OCR deep learning method and a storage medium based on a block chain mechanism. Background technique [0002] The current common OCR scheme is a top-down method based on sliding window full-image scanning and a bottom-up method based on underlying rules to first segment small areas and then combine them into text areas. The deep learning of OCR is based on the 5-layer CNN network of HOG feature input as the OCR recognition model. In the recognition network training, CNN needs to recognize complex characters. The problem it faces is how to obtain enough training samples that meet the diversity. Only when the training samples meet the diversity can the OCR recognition network that meets the business needs be trained. [0003] Traditional text recognition is based on template matching, which has high requirements for feature description, and it is difficult to meet the recognition 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06K9/32G06K9/62
CPCG06V20/63G06V30/10G06F18/214
Inventor 刘德建于恩涛陈伟刘萍林剑锋范剑敏林琛
Owner 福建天晴在线互动科技有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products